Interior Renovation at 107 Greenwich Street, Manhattan
107 GREENWICH STREET, MANHATTAN, 10006 · Financial District-Battery Park City
What was permitted
In the Financial District-Battery Park City neighborhood, an interior renovation of an existing 15th-floor space at 107 Greenwich Street is underway. This project aims to update the interior without altering the building's fundamental use, egress, or occupancy.
This permit was issued on June 22, 2026, with an estimated project cost of $178,418.17. UNITY CONSTRUCTION GROUP is the general contractor managing this renovation.
